About Quadring
The village of Quadring is a small village in Lincolnshire. The name means "muddy dump".
The village church of St Margaret, is some distance from the village itself. It is said that the village took it upon itself to move away from the church during the 14th century to escape the Black Death - the most devastating pandemic in human history. Add town to favourites
